Grupo de Inversiones Suramericana S.A
Grupo de Inversiones Suramericana S.A., through its subsidiaries, invests in the financial services sector in Colombia, Chile, Mexico, Brazil, Uruguay, Panama, Peru, Dominican Republic, El Salvador, Argentina, the United States, Luxembourg, and Bermuda. Grupo de Inversiones Suramericana S.A - Asset Resilience Ratio
Grupo de Inversiones Suramericana S.A (GIVPY) has an Asset Resilience Ratio of 0.90% as of September 2025. The Asset Resilience Ratio measures the percentage of a company's total assets that are held in liquid form (cash and short-term investments). This metric indicates how well-positioned the company is to handle unexpected financial challenges, economic downturns, or strategic opportunities without requiring external financing.

Annual Asset Resilience Ratio for Grupo de Inversiones Suramericana S.A (2007–2023)
The table below shows the annual Asset Resilience Ratio data for Grupo de Inversiones Suramericana S.A.
| Year | Asset Resilience Ratio (%) | Liquid Assets | Total Assets | Change |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2023-12-31 | 0.96% | $900.92 Billion | $93.50 Trillion | -0.25pp |
| 2022-12-31 | 1.21% | $1.19 Trillion | $98.39 Trillion | -0.04pp |
| 2021-12-31 | 1.25% | $947.58 Billion | $75.90 Trillion | +0.05pp |
| 2020-12-31 | 1.19% | $846.14 Billion | $70.86 Trillion | +0.33pp |
| 2019-12-31 | 0.87% | $599.51 Billion | $69.04 Trillion | +0.90pp |
| 2018-12-31 | -0.03% | $-21.05 Billion | $71.07 Trillion | -39.06pp |
| 2017-12-31 | 39.03% | $26.93 Trillion | $68.99 Trillion | +32.16pp |
| 2014-12-31 | 6.86% | $3.24 Trillion | $47.21 Trillion | +1.56pp |
| 2013-12-31 | 5.30% | $2.14 Trillion | $40.26 Trillion | -3.71pp |
| 2012-12-31 | 9.01% | $3.37 Trillion | $37.38 Trillion | +2.42pp |
| 2011-12-31 | 6.60% | $2.13 Trillion | $32.30 Trillion | -4.66pp |
| 2010-12-31 | 11.25% | $2.58 Trillion | $22.91 Trillion | +0.82pp |
| 2009-12-31 | 10.43% | $1.95 Trillion | $18.67 Trillion | -4.91pp |
| 2008-12-31 | 15.34% | $1.94 Trillion | $12.63 Trillion | -0.36pp |
| 2007-12-31 | 15.70% | $2.22 Trillion | $14.17 Trillion | -- |
